10. Calaboose African American History Museum

Calaboose African American History Museum

The Calaboose African American History Museum in San Marcos is a small museum located in a former jail from 1873.

This unique and historic building now houses a collection of artifacts and exhibits that trace the local African-American history of the area. Upon entering the museum, visitors are immediately transported back in time.

The old jail cells have been transformed into displays that showcase the struggles and triumphs of the African-American community in San Marcos.

The atmosphere is filled with a sense of history and reverence for those who came before. The artifacts on display at the Calaboose Museum are fascinating and provide a glimpse into the lives of those who lived in this community.

From personal items and clothing to photographs and documents, each piece tells a story.

Calaboose African American History Museum

Visitors can learn about the lives of influential figures, such as community leaders, activists, and artists who have shaped the history of San Marcos. The exhibits at the museum offer a comprehensive overview of the African-American experience in the area.

16. Sewell Park

Sewell Park

Sewell Park is a beautiful park located in San Marcos, Texas. It is owned by Texas State University and is situated along the picturesque San Marcos River.

This park is a popular destination for locals and visitors alike due to its stunning natural beauty and the variety of activities it offers. One of the main attractions of Sewell Park is the 72-degree San Marcos River.

The river is known for its crystal-clear waters, which are perfect for swimming, tubing, and kayaking. The cool temperature of the water makes it particularly refreshing, especially during the hot summer months.

Many people flock to Sewell Park to enjoy a relaxing day by the river, soaking up the sun and taking a dip in the refreshing water. If you’re looking for some outdoor fun, Sewell Park has got you covered.

The park features several volleyball courts where you can gather a group of friends or join a pickup game. Volleyball is a great way to stay active and enjoy some friendly competition while enjoying the beautiful surroundings.
